メディアクエリ(Media Queries)の罠 – $(window).width()とスクロールバー 2015-05-26 JavaScript スクロールバーが表示される場合その幅を含んでしまうということです。 メディアクエリだけで、レスポンシブWebデザインを行うのであれば、ブレークポイントのずれがないので、問題ありません。 しかし、JavaScriptを一緒に使う場合は、注意が必要です。 jQueryでWindowサイズを取得する場合、このように書くことが多いと思います。 これだと、スクロールバーの幅が含まれていないので、15~20pxくらいメディアクエリと差が出てしまいます。 jQuery if ( $(window).width() < 768 ){ ... } レスポンシブで、メディアクエリとともにJavaScriptを併用するとき、メディアクエリ側でスクロールバーを含むの
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く